HPCL may resume buying Iran oil after eased sanction

Hindustan Petroleum Corp is actively considering resumption of Iranian oil purchases after western sanctions against the OPEC member are eased, its head of refineries said on Monday. HPCL stopped buying Iranian crude in April due to insurance problems triggered by EU sanctions. But a landmark deal to curb Tehran's nuclear programme struck on Sunday includes easing of some restrictions that should end these insurance problems. ...
